Output 29674bd70fa19398303eb84c62c76c47b380830d757c2cbd4f1fe9f565c635ba:0

value
1029989
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18fd2d5584a74d3ef82cc9ed59d7bb611b8a62e8 OP_EQUAL
address
33y9SCZ8J1BG6moM84LPgxVA254EA7PTVK
transaction
29674bd70fa19398303eb84c62c76c47b380830d757c2cbd4f1fe9f565c635ba
spent
true